    3. element classification

    Content module in schema

    empty: no children elements nor text nodes.

    simple: only text nodes are accepted.

    complex: only subelements are expected.

    mixed: both text nodes and subelements can be present


    Type module in schema

    simple type: simple content and no attribute

    complex type: all other cases

    5. user defined simpletype

    derivation by restriction

    A derivation by restriction is done using a xs:restriction element and each facet is defined using a specific element embedded in the xs:restriction element. The datatype on which the restriction is applied is called the base datatype, which can be referenced though a <base> attribute or defined in the xs:restriction element.

    <xs:simpleType name="myInteger">

    <xs:restriction base="xs:integer">

    <xs:minInclusive value="-2"/>

    <xs:maxExclusive value="5"/>

    </xs:restriction>

    </xs:simpleType>


    xs:pattern: works on the lexical space; all the other facets constrain the value space.

    xs:enumeration: allows definition of a list of possible values.

    xs:length: defines a fixed length measured in number of characters (general case) or bytes (xs:hexBinary and xs:base64Binary)

    xs:maxLength: defines a maximum length measured in number of characters (general case) or bytes (xs:hexBinary and xs:base64Binary)

    xs:minLength: defines a minimum length measured in number of characters (general case) or bytes (hexBinary and base64Binary)

    xs:whitespace: defines the way to handle whitespaces. The values of an xs:whiteSpace facet are "preserve" (whitespaces are kept unchanged), "replace" (all the instances of any whitespace are replaced with a space), and "collapse" (leading and trailing whitespaces are removed and all the other sequences of contiguous whitespaces are replaced by a single space).

    xs:maxExclusive: defines a maximum value that cannot be reached.

    xs:maxInclusive: defines a maximum value that can be reached.

    xs:minExclusive: defines a minimum value that cannot be reached

    xs:minInclusive: defines a minimum value that can be reached

    xs:totalDigits: defines the maximum number of decimal digits.

    xs:fractionDigits: specifies the maximum number of decimal digits in the fractional part (after the dot).


    derivation by list

    use a xs:list element, allows a definition by reference to existing types or embeds a type definition, two definition cannot be mixed.

    These facets are xs:length, xs:maxLength, xs:minLength, xs:enumeration and xs:whiteSpace.

    <xs:simpleType name="integerList">

    <xs:list itemType="xs:integer"/>

    </xs:simpleType>


    <xs:simpleType name="myIntegerList">

    <xs:list>

    <xs:simpleType>

    <xs:restriction base="xs:integer">

    <xs:maxInclusive value="100"/>

    </xs:restriction>

    </xs:simpleType>

    </xs:list>

    </xs:simpleType>


    derivation by union

    using a xs:union element, allowing a definition by reference to existing types or by embedding type definition, Both styles can be mixed

    The only two facets that can be applied to a union datatype are xs:pattern and xs:enumeration

    <xs:simpleType name="integerOrData">

    <xs:union memberTypes="xs:integer xs:date"/>

    </xs:simpleType>


    <xs:simpleType name="myIntegerUnion">

    <xs:union>

    <xs:simpleType>

    <xs:restriction base="xs:integer"/>

    </xs:simpleType>

    <xs:simpleType>

    <xs:restriction base="xs:NMTOKEN">

    <xs:enumeration value="undefined"/>

    </xs:restriction>

    </xs:simpleType>

    </xs:union>

    </xs:simpleType>

    Schema for simpleType element

    <xs:element name=”” type=””/>

    <xs:attribute name=”” type=””/>

    Schema for complexType element

    define complexType directly

    <xs:element name="employee">

    <xs:complexType>

    <xs:sequence>

    <xs:element name="firstname" type="xs:string"/>

    <xs:element name="lastname" type="xs:string"/>

    </xs:sequence>

    </xs:complexType>

    </xs:element>

    ref to complex data type

    <xs:element name="employee" type="personinfo"/>

    <xs:complexType name="personinfo">

    <xs:sequence>

    <xs:element name="firstname" type="xs:string"/>

    <xs:element name="lastname" type="xs:string"/>

    </xs:sequence>

    </xs:complexType>


    Empty content

    <xs:element name=””>

    <xs:complexType>

    <xs:attribute name=”” type=””/>

    </xs:complexType>

    </xs:element>

    Simple content

    <xs:element name=””>

    <xs:complexType>

    <xs:simpleContent>

    <xs:restriction base=””>

    <xs:attribute name=”” type=””/>

    </xs:restribution>

    </xs:simpleContent>

    </xs:complexType>

    </xs:element>

    Complex content

    <xs:element name=””>

    <xs:complexType>

    <xs:sequence>

    <xs:element name=”” type=””/>

    </xs:sequence>

    <xs:attribute name=”” type=””/>

    </xs:complexType>

    </xs:element>

    Mixed content

    <xs:element name=””>

    <xs:complexType mixed=”true”>

    <xs:sequence>

    <xs:element name=”” type=””/>

    </xs:sequence>

    <xs:attribute name=”” type=””/>

    </xs:complexType>

    </xs:element>

    Local definition

    <?xml version="1.0" encoding="ISO-8859-1" ?>

    <xs:schema xmlns:xs="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ema">

    <xs:element name="shiporder">

    <xs:complexType>

    <xs:sequence>

    <xs:element name="orderperson" type="xs:string"/>

    <xs:element name="shipto">

    <xs:complexType>

    <xs:sequence>

    <xs:element name="name" type="xs:string"/>

    <xs:element name="address" type="xs:string"/>

    <xs:element name="city" type="xs:string"/>

    <xs:element name="country" type="xs:string"/>

    </xs:sequence>

    </xs:complexType>

    </xs:element>

    <xs:element name="item" maxOccurs="unbounded">

    <xs:complexType>

    <xs:sequence>

    <xs:element name="title" type="xs:string"/>

    <xs:element name="note" type="xs:string" minOccurs="0"/>

    <xs:element name="quantity" type="xs:positiveInteger"/>

    <xs:element name="price" type="xs:decimal"/>

    </xs:sequence>

    </xs:complexType>

    </xs:element>

    </xs:sequence>

    <xs:attribute name="orderid" type="xs:string" use="required"/>

    </xs:complexType>

    </xs:element>

    </xs:schema>


    Named type definition.

    <?xml version="1.0" encoding="ISO-8859-1" ?>

    <xs:schema xmlns:xs="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ema">


    <xs:simpleType name="stringtype">

    <xs:restriction base="xs:string"/>

    </xs:simpleType>


    <xs:simpleType name="inttype">

    <xs:restriction base="xs:positiveInteger"/>

    </xs:simpleType>


    <xs:simpleType name="dectype">

    <xs:restriction base="xs:decimal"/>

    </xs:simpleType>


    <xs:simpleType name="orderidtype">

    <xs:restriction base="xs:string">

    <xs:pattern value="[0-9]{6}"/>

    </xs:restriction>

    </xs:simpleType>


    <xs:complexType name="shiptotype">

    <xs:sequence>

    <xs:element name="name" type="stringtype"/>

    <xs:element name="address" type="stringtype"/>

    <xs:element name="city" type="stringtype"/>

    <xs:element name="country" type="stringtype"/>

    </xs:sequence>

    </xs:complexType>


    <xs:complexType name="itemtype">

    <xs:sequence>

    <xs:element name="title" type="stringtype"/>

    <xs:element name="note" type="stringtype" minOccurs="0"/>

    <xs:element name="quantity" type="inttype"/>

    <xs:element name="price" type="dectype"/>

    </xs:sequence>

    </xs:complexType>


    <xs:complexType name="shipordertype">

    <xs:sequence>

    <xs:element name="orderperson" type="stringtype"/>

    <xs:element name="shipto" type="shiptotype"/>

    <xs:element name="item" maxOccurs="unbounded" type="itemtype"/>

    </xs:sequence>

    <xs:attribute name="orderid" type="orderidtype" use="required"/>

    </xs:complexType>


    <xs:element name="shiporder" type="shipordertype"/>


    </xs:schema>
